Common Indicators of Roofing Damages
When you evaluate your roof, look carefully for common indicators of damage that can bring about larger issues later on.
Beginning by checking for missing or fractured shingles; these can allow water to seep in and cause leakages. Pay attention to granule loss, which can indicate that tiles are aging and losing their safety layer.
Next, check out the flashing around chimneys and vents. If you find rust or spaces, water can quickly enter your home.
Seek drooping locations on the roofing, as this could indicate structural damages or the buildup of dampness.
Do not fail to remember to check for moss or algae growth; while they may seem safe, they can trap moisture and accelerate damage.
Check the rain gutters for particles and indications of water overflow, as this can show a clog or inappropriate drainage.
Lastly, watch on your ceilings and wall surfaces for water discolorations or peeling off paint, as these could be clues that your roofing is dripping.
Attending to these signs quickly can assist you stay clear of a lot more considerable repair work and extend the lifespan of your roof.
Inspecting Your Roofing Frequently
Routine roof assessments are critical for maintaining the integrity of your home. By keeping a close eye on your roof covering, you can catch troubles early, saving yourself time and money in the long run. Purpose to evaluate your roof covering at least twice a year-- when in the spring and once in the fall. This timing helps you resolve any damages caused by wintertime weather and plan for the future seasons.
When inspecting, begin with the ground. When to Call a Professional
Frequently, home owners think twice to call a professional for roof problems, believing they can manage repair work themselves. However, recognizing when to look for assistance can save you time, money, and stress and anxiety. If you see substantial leakages, considerable water damages, or dark areas on your ceilings, don't wait. These signs may suggest major hidden troubles that require experienced interest.
If your roof is older than twenty years, also small problems can intensify rapidly. Cracked roof shingles, missing ceramic tiles, or drooping locations are red flags that warrant a professional evaluation.
In addition, if you're uncomfortable climbing onto your roofing system or do not have the needed tools and experience, it's best to leave it to the pros.
When tornado damages takes place, such as hailstorm or high winds, it's crucial to obtain an evaluation from a certified contractor. They can identify concealed concerns that might jeopardize your home's integrity.
Finally, if you've tried repair services yet the issue lingers, do not wait to call a professional. They'll bring the understanding and abilities needed to guarantee your roofing system is safe and sound.
